Output 379386fb1c81ab153c322587308437f022e3afca21e97e17c6818cd8f1a3c481:1

value
38150786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b9704f4e23b267717f466f36bf1213a6bbbe561 OP_EQUALVERIFY OP_CHECKSIG
address
16S5nKygn6LhnaJwoNRyhcy68sgpSRmKvb
transaction
379386fb1c81ab153c322587308437f022e3afca21e97e17c6818cd8f1a3c481
spent
true